Formats and file-size limits

Only JPG and PNG are accepted. Each file must be between 10 KB and 5 MB. Noncompliant sizes cause failures or persistent pending states.

Field Suggested Tips
Formats PNG or JPG PNG for graphics/edges; JPG for photos
Size 10 KB–5 MB Balance compression with clarity for Maps/thumbnail views
Cover size ≈1332×750 px Design to work when cropped to square and mobile views
Review time 24–48 hours Uploads show statuses: Pending, Not approved, Live

Answer Writing That Builds Trust and Drives Conversions

Plain, helpful replies can convert casual searches into bookings or sales. Adopt a friendly, professional tone and lead with the answer. Short sentences and concrete facts build credibility and foster engagement.

Tone and format

Start with a direct answer, then add one or two sentences of context. Keep paragraphs short and wording simple. When policies matter, label them clearly—refund policy, appointment window, accessibility options—to reduce uncertainty.

Content guidelines

Align voice with your website and profile content. Show availability, exact locations, or timeframes when relevant. For menu or service questions, provide specifics such as “We offer gluten-free pizza at our downtown Chicago location” rather than vague claims.

Natural Keyword Usage

Work keywords into natural replies. For example, mention Google Q&A management when explaining who handles responses, or note that quick answers help search engine ranking for local queries. Avoid repetition and place terms naturally to strengthen online presence.

Using Links, Photos, and Follow-Ups

Include links only when they enable actions like booking, viewing menus, or checking directions. Attach a photo to clarify details such as parking or entrances. Close with a clear call to action: call, book online, or message us.

Practical reply examples

  • “Yes — we accept walk-ins and online reservations for our Seattle clinic. Call at 206-555-0123 to secure the same-day slot.”
  • “Our downtown location has free street parking and an accessible ramp. See the attached photo for the entrance.”
  • “Refunds are available within 30 days for unopened items.”

Managing Incorrect/Negative Answers and Reputation Risk

Incorrect or negative answers can damage trust and reduce visibility. Swift, calm, fact-based responses protect reputation. Use alerts and regular checks to find harmful claims before they spread.

Quickly Identifying Harmful or Inaccurate Answers

Enable Q&A notifications and watch for safety or refund keywords. Focus on answers that could mislead customers. Audit Q&A weekly and compare against verified details to spot misinformation.

How to flag content, suggest edits, and reclaim control when needed

If an answer is incorrect, respond with clear corrections and supporting evidence. Use “flag as inappropriate” for policy-violating content. If a listing error keeps happening, update your profile fields or contact Google Business Profile support.
